Who/What is Armson A.E?

Armson A.E – Armson Automotive Engineers –  Was originally just about me Stuart Armson a Land Rover enthusiast,  a Land Rover owner and a Ex-Land Rover trained technician,  But things change and how they have changed in 12 years!

I started my apprenticeship at the age of 7,  helping my father fix his trucks at weekends.  In 1987 my father bought his first Land Rover a V8 110 Rowen brown station wagon, the seed was sown and you can see where this is going.

In 1991 I started my first job at a local Land Rover dealer and started my second apprenticeship.  Many years later and a few different manufactures later I became dissolution with working for others and took the plunge and started Armson A.E. that was January 1st 2009.

At the start I was traveling all over the country as one of the first mobile Land Rover specialist in the country,  After a few years it became apparent that I needed a workshop the work load and the type of jobs were not ones that could be done on a drive in the snow any longer,  I searched and found a unit in Syston and on December the 3rd 2010 I opened.

Over the last 16 years I have gone though a recession, nearly gone bust, lost staff, gained staff.

Then Covid struck! Then the government struck! I was left in a predicament carry on, go bust, sell up!

Over the following months I struggled with supply of parts but was enjoying the work, building Land Rover’s again and fixing V8’s, I had hardly done any Mot’s or regular car servicing or repairs (I was servicing and doing Mot tests for medical and emergency services as required) but I was struggling for space to do full rebuilds and space was needed!

In December 2020 I sold the Mot part of the business, cleared out all my kit and cars and parts and moved to Billesdon. January 1st 2021 exactly 12 years after starting the business,  I am starting again in a new building but rather than trying to do everything on every car, I am specialising on :- series 3, 90/110/130 from 1985 to 2016, Range Rover Classic, Range Rover P38a, Discovery 1/2, Freelander 1/2.
